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-6934 : Exploit Details and Defense Strategies

CVE-2023-6934 is a Stored Cross-Site Scripting flaw in WordPress plugin up to version 2.25.26. Attackers can inject malicious scripts with contributor-level access.

This CVE-2023-6934 involves a vulnerability found in the Limit Login Attempts Reloaded plugin for WordPress, allowing for Stored Cross-Site Scripting attacks up to version 2.25.26. The flaw stems from inadequate input sanitization and output escaping in user-supplied attributes, enabling authenticated attackers with contributor-level permissions or higher to inject malicious web scripts.

Understanding CVE-2023-6934

This section delves into the specifics of the CVE-2023-6934 vulnerability impacting the Limit Login Attempts Reloaded plugin for WordPress.

What is CVE-2023-6934?

CVE-2023-6934 is a Stored Cross-Site Scripting vulnerability existing in versions up to 2.25.26 of the Limit Login Attempts Reloaded plugin for WordPress. Exploitation of this flaw can lead to arbitrary web script injection by authenticated attackers with contributor-level permissions or above.

The Impact of CVE-2023-6934

The vulnerability poses a medium-severity risk (CVSS base score of 6.4) to affected systems, potentially allowing attackers to execute malicious scripts within the context of a user accessing compromised pages.

Technical Details of CVE-2023-6934

Explore the technical aspects related to the CVE-2023-6934 vulnerability, including its description, affected systems, and exploitation mechanism.

Vulnerability Description

The vulnerability arises from insufficient input sanitization and output escaping within the plugin's shortcode(s), facilitating the injection of malicious web scripts by authenticated attackers possessing contributor-level permissions or above.

Affected Systems and Versions

The CVE-2023-6934 vulnerability impacts all versions of the Limit Login Attempts Reloaded plugin for WordPress up to and including version 2.25.26.

Exploitation Mechanism

By leveraging the inadequate input sanitization and output escaping in user-supplied attributes, attackers with contributor-level permissions or higher can inject and execute arbitrary web scripts on compromised pages.

Mitigation and Prevention

Discover the necessary steps to mitigate the CVE-2023-6934 vulnerability and prevent potential security risks.

Immediate Steps to Take

        Update the Limit Login Attempts Reloaded plugin to a version beyond 2.25.26 to eliminate the vulnerability.
        Regularly monitor security advisories from plugin developers and security researchers for patches and updates.

Long-Term Security Practices

        Employ strict input validation and output encoding practices to prevent Cross-Site Scripting (XSS) vulnerabilities.
        Educate users with higher permissions about the risks of executing arbitrary scripts via input fields.

Patching and Updates

Stay informed about security patches and updates released by the plugin vendor to address vulnerabilities like CVE-2023-6934 and enhance overall security posture within WordPress environments.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now